--- Part Two ---
|
||||
|
||||
To make things a little more interesting, the Elf introduces one additional rule. Now, J cards are jokers - wildcards that can act like whatever card would make the hand the strongest type possible.
|
||||
|
||||
To balance this, J cards are now the weakest individual cards, weaker even than 2. The other cards stay in the same order: A, K, Q, T, 9, 8, 7, 6, 5, 4, 3, 2, J.
|
||||
|
||||
J cards can pretend to be whatever card is best for the purpose of determining hand type; for example, QJJQ2 is now considered four of a kind. However, for the purpose of breaking ties between two hands of the same type, J is always treated as J, not the card it's pretending to be: JKKK2 is weaker than QQQQ2 because J is weaker than Q.
|
||||
|
||||
Now, the above example goes very differently:
|
||||
|
||||
32T3K 765
|
||||
T55J5 684
|
||||
KK677 28
|
||||
KTJJT 220
|
||||
QQQJA 483
|
||||
|
||||
32T3K is still the only one pair; it doesn't contain any jokers, so its strength doesn't increase.
|
||||
KK677 is now the only two pair, making it the second-weakest hand.
|
||||
T55J5, KTJJT, and QQQJA are now all four of a kind! T55J5 gets rank 3, QQQJA gets rank 4, and KTJJT gets rank 5.
|
||||
|
||||
With the new joker rule, the total winnings in this example are 5905.
|
||||
|
||||
Using the new joker rule, find the rank of every hand in your set. What are the new total winnings?
